Abstract: 
   In May 2013, the United States, the United Kingdom, Canada, and Australia signed a Memorandum of Understanding, establishing the International Foreign Bribery Taskforce that will meet annually to discuss trends and challenges related to foreign bribery crimes and share methodologies and best practices.[1]
